Skee Mask Breaks Down His Studio Essentials
Our latest cover star is one of the most revered, guarded and notoriously principled artists working in electronic music. This film shows him where he's happiest: his new home studio in Berlin, surrounded by over 75 bits of hardware, including the Roland TR-909, Nord Micro Modular and Samson S-PATCH Plus.
